Design, facilitate, and support the hybrid virtual learning environment to meet the needs of all learners. Hybrid virtual learning, made so popular during the pandemic, is perhaps the most challenging training environment. Not only do we need to intellectually engage individual learners, but we also need to anticipate and accommodate so many different scenarios!   

The approach to this workshop is scenario-based. Participants will work together to develop a training plan for a hypothetical company (“Bluebird Technologies”) to tackle the intricacies of their global hybrid training requirements. Issues to be addressed in the workshop will include helping individuals learn while in a classroom, office, or at home, variances in instructional experience on a variety of devices, and optimizing design and delivery for a hybrid audience. Hybrid virtual training is complicated - but you’ll help to ensure Bluebird Technologies leaves no learner behind.   

Learning Outcomes

The Hybrid Virtual Training Workshop is focused on providing hands-on, immersive experiences so learning professionals leave with a solid foundation on the topic. At the end of this workshop, you will be able to: 

  • Articulate the importance of hybrid virtual learning in the modern workplace. 
  • Define the elements of a hybrid learning program, including the impact of mobile, global, and virtual learning environments. 
  • Incorporate learning technologies (video, breakout rooms, whiteboards, 3rd party integrations) that are accessible and effective for all environments. 
  • Include activity design options that are effective for a hybrid learning audience. 
  • Re-imagine the role of the producer as the learner advocate for all participants, no matter how they are participating.  
  • Facilitate in a way that maximizes engagement and psychological safety of all learners. 
  • Adapt activities ‘in the moment’ to accommodate the actual audience composition.  
  • Blend self-directed and ‘remote group’ learning activities into the program to connect learners in between live session.
